Output e6123598597fa7e2d705e08a9e5fb39f7d0c780d15e9f9c069ef52bdbda40145:2

value
352251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d08d206b43f3fb5a5246a9a6637435df768a7c5 OP_EQUAL
address
3JvYCepVtCxHkpH4hydyJrqV1QC712HeMJ
transaction
e6123598597fa7e2d705e08a9e5fb39f7d0c780d15e9f9c069ef52bdbda40145
spent
true